Mission St & 8th St
1170 Mission St
San Francisco, CA 94103
The bus stop at Mission St & 8th St is located in the bustling neighborhood of San Francisco, CA. They find themselves within a vibrant urban environment, surrounded by a mix of residential buildings, shops, and eateries. This stop serves as a vital transit point, providing easy access to various bus lines that connect riders to different parts of the city. The area buzzes with the energy of pedestrians, street art, and a diverse community, showcasing the unique tapestry of life in San Francisco.
Generated from this place's information
See a problem?